CVE-2021-31997 : Vulnerability Insights and Analysis

Learn about CVE-2021-31997, a medium severity vulnerability allowing local attackers to escalate privileges in python-postorius. Find out the impacted systems and mitigation steps.

A vulnerability in python-postorius of openSUSE Leap 15.2 and Factory allows local attackers to escalate privileges from users postorius or postorius-admin to root. This CVE has a CVSS base score of 6.8, indicating a medium severity threat.

What is CVE-2021-31997?

CVE-2021-31997 is a UNIX Symbolic Link (Symlink) Following vulnerability in python-postorius that enables local privilege escalation from non-root users to root on affected systems.

The Impact of CVE-2021-31997

The impact of this vulnerability is significant as it allows local attackers to gain root access on systems running openSUSE Leap 15.2 and Factory through python-postorius.

Vulnerability Description

The vulnerability arises from improper handling of symbolic links in python-postorius, enabling the unauthorized escalation of user privileges.

Affected Systems and Versions

        Affected Vendor: openSUSE
        Affected Products and Versions:
              openSUSE Leap 15.2: python-postorius version 1.3.2-lp152.1.2 and prior
              openSUSE Factory: python-postorius version 1.3.4-2.1 and prior

Exploitation Mechanism

Local attackers can exploit this vulnerability by manipulating symbolic links within python-postorius to gain unauthorized root access.
